西班牙marià castelló, arquitecte最近在福门特拉岛上的古老农宅之间完成了一个泳池及休
闲区。为了与当地传统农居协调,设计采用了石砌房屋,紧邻房屋布置平台和泳池,这里
拥有开阔的自然美景,同时也完全渗透入景色之中。不连续的石砌矮墙围绕泳池。规格为
60x40x2厘米的白色大理石片贴在泳池表面,木质平台的材料为实行松木。南侧紧靠房屋
的平台安置了轻盈的棚架,棚架结构是镀锌钢,覆盖物是细长的植物条。

The project issues from the desire to create a bath and recreation area as core of
relationship between the two centenary houses of Can Xomeu Sord, located in the
Vénda de Sa Talaissa (La Mola) on the island of Formentera.
With the objective of the integration on the landscape, the intervention must be rooted
in the complex weave of walls and traditional dry stone outbuildings that characterize
this type of traditional rural settlements in the smaller of the Pitiüsas. This limitation
became an opportunity to formalize a subtle filter between the two houses that offers a
close but border meeting area, open to the beautiful view of the lighthouse of La Mola
but intimate, that permeates local tradition while echoes the modernity.
The space bounded by two parallel walls and an old farmyard, set the main guidelines,
the precise location and some of the construction details of the intervention. The water
sheet of four by fifteen meters searches tangency with the east wall, becoming
overflowing over it. The trace of the East wall coincides with the water surface but only
dematerialized to leave this footprint of gravels from the same stone as the wall. From
that precise limit continues free the natural and heterogeneous topsoil.
